Circular Connectors

1. Overview

Circular connectors are multi-pin electrical connectors with circular contact arrangements, designed for reliable signal/power transmission in harsh environments. They feature robust mechanical structures, environmental sealing, and high mating durability. These connectors are critical in aerospace, industrial automation, and medical equipment where vibration resistance and signal integrity are paramount.

3. Structure & Components

Typical construction includes: - Shell: Aluminum alloy/zinc die-cast housing with corrosion-resistant plating - Contacts: Gold-plated phosphor bronze with 0.5-2.0mm diameter - Insulation: High-temperature thermoplastic (200 C rating) - Sealing: IP67/IP68 rated elastomer gaskets - Mounting: Threaded/flange/clamp mechanisms

4. Key Technical Parameters

ParameterTypical RangeImportance
Voltage Rating50V-600VDetermines power transmission capacity
Current Rating1A-25A/contactAffects thermal performance
Contact Resistance 5m Impacts signal integrity
IP RatingIP40-IP68Defines environmental protection level
Operating Temp-65 C to +200 CMaterial stability indicator
Mating Cycles500-10,000Service life predictor

7. Selection Guidelines

Key considerations: 1. Environmental factors: Temperature extremes, fluid exposure 2. Electrical requirements: Signal type (analog/digital), current load 3. Mechanical constraints: Panel space, mating force limitations 4. Compliance standards: MIL-STD, ISO 6722, RoHS 5. Cost vs. longevity: High-cycle applications justify premium connectors

8. Industry Trends

Emerging developments include: - Miniaturization: 1.0mm contact pitch enabling wearable devices - High-speed transmission: 25Gbps+ differential pairs for industrial IoT - Smart connectors: Integrated sensors for condition monitoring - Material innovation: Graphene-coated contacts reducing resistance - Eco-design: Halogen-free thermoplastics meeting REACH regulations
